Oldie, but Goodies
Math
- This week we continued with fraction by fraction multiplication, models to understand our thinking, and generalizations about products of fraction multiplication.
- Next week we will take our second Bridges Interim Assessment before we continue with Unit 5 Module 4.
- Our March Number Corner will be focused on area of objects using multiplication of decimals. In addition, each week we will be gathering data of pencil lengths, placing the data in a line plot, analyzing data and making predictions.
Literacy this week
- This week we started Module 3 which is about athletes for social change. Our text is Promises to Keep written by Sharon Robinson. The book is about her father, Jackie Robinson.
- This week we explored the text, summarized parts of the book and started thinking about characteristics people possess for social change.
- For ALL Block, we continue to work with vocabulary words, writing responses to our reading and fluency work.
Science--
Our third unit will be on Modeling Matter as we answer the question: What happens when two substances are mixed together?
- Our first chapter will focus on : Why did the food coloring separate into different dyes?
- Our second chapter will focus on : Why do some salad dressings have sediments and others do not?
- Our third chapter will focus on : Why can salad dressing ingredients separate again after being mixed?
